
2 Cor 5:11-21; John 21:15-19"As there can be no above without a below, no before without an after, so there can be no...history of salvation between God and humanity without its reflection and repetition in a history between one person and another. [But this] can take place only as those who are loved by God and love Him in return enjoy and make use of the freedom to love one another. If it is ever the case that they seem to be missing God’s love and their own love for God...the root of the trouble may be quite simply that they are not ready to make use of this freedom, and are not engaged in this confirmation of God’s love and their own love for Him." -- Karl Barth, Church Dogmatics IV.2
